How they compare

Luxembourg currently reports 105.0% against 98.7% in ESCAP: Wb Upper Middle Income Economies (wb_upper_mid) (unsdcode:98437), a difference of 6.3%.

That makes Luxembourg's figure about 1.1 times ESCAP: Wb Upper Middle Income Economies (wb_upper_mid) (unsdcode:98437)'s.

Across all 23 years both countries report, Luxembourg has been ahead every year.

ESCAP: Wb Upper Middle Income Economies (wb_upper_mid) (unsdcode:98437) ranks 44th and Luxembourg ranks 43rd of 221 groups.

Luxembourg has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ade ESCAP: Wb Upper Middle Income Economies (wb_upper_mid) (unsdcode:98437) Luxembourg Difference Ahead
2000s 87.4% 98.3% 10.8% Luxembourg
2010s 96.8% 102.0% 5.1% Luxembourg
2020s 98.1% 104.1% 6.0% Luxembourg

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
